Analysis
Ethiopia recorded 3.70 billion for statistical discrepancy (expenditure approach) in 2018.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.
That represents a change of up 2,013.9% on the previous year and up 232.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, statistical discrepancy (expenditure approach) in Ethiopia peaked at 3.70 billion in 2018 and was at its lowest, -227.48 million, in 2002.
That places Ethiopia 5th out of 43 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
